The Rise of Real-Time Reporting and its Impact

The evolution of news delivery has been significantly shaped by the advent of the internet and social media. Gone are the days when individuals relied solely on scheduled broadcasts or daily newspapers for their news intake. Now, information is available instantaneously, and the demand for immediate updates is higher than ever before. This shift has spurred the rise of real-time reporting, which prioritizes speed and immediacy in disseminating information. Platforms like capitalize on this trend, offering live coverage of breaking news events and providing users with a constant stream of updates as stories unfold. This capability is particularly valuable in situations where time is of the essence, such as natural disasters or political crises.

Challenges of Verifying Information in Real-Time

However, the emphasis on speed in real-time reporting also presents significant challenges, particularly in terms of verifying information before it is published. The pressure to be first to report can sometimes lead to the dissemination of inaccurate or unconfirmed reports. This underscores the importance of robust fact-checking mechanisms and responsible journalism practices. and similar platforms must prioritize accuracy and transparency, even in the face of intense competition. Employing skilled editors, utilizing reliable sources, and actively monitoring user-generated content are crucial steps in mitigating the risk of spreading misinformation and maintaining the platform's credibility.

The Role of Citizen Journalism

Citizen journalism, also known as participatory journalism, involves the active involvement of the public in the news gathering and reporting process. Individuals equipped with smartphones and social media accounts can now document events as they unfold and share them with a global audience. This has the potential to provide firsthand accounts of events that might otherwise go unreported, particularly in areas where traditional media access is limited. facilitates citizen journalism by providing a platform for individuals to submit their own news stories and perspectives. However, it’s crucial to acknowledge that citizen journalism also presents challenges, such as verifying the accuracy of user-generated content and ensuring that reporters adhere to ethical standards.

Combating Misinformation and Promoting Media Literacy

The spread of misinformation has become a major challenge in the digital age. The ease with which false or misleading information can be created and disseminated online poses a threat to public trust and democratic processes. Platforms like have a responsibility to combat misinformation and promote media literacy among their users. This can involve implementing fact-checking mechanisms, partnering with independent fact-checking organizations, and providing users with tools to assess the credibility of news sources. Additionally, the promotion of media literacy initiatives can empower individuals to critically evaluate information and identify potential bias or falsehoods.

Strategies for Identifying and Addressing Fake News

Identifying and addressing fake news requires a multi-faceted approach. This includes utilizing artificial intelligence (AI) to detect patterns associated with misinformation, employing human fact-checkers to verify the accuracy of claims, and implementing algorithms that prioritize credible sources. Platforms should also provide users with clear and transparent labeling of potentially misleading content, allowing them to make informed decisions about what they read and share. Furthermore, fostering collaboration between tech companies, journalists, and educators is essential to develop effective strategies for combating misinformation and promoting media literacy on a wider scale. Expanding Horizons: New Avenues for Investigative Reporting

Technological advancements are not just changing how news is consumed, but also what news is possible to report. The availability of large datasets, coupled with sophisticated analytical tools, is opening up new avenues for investigative journalism. Complex issues, such as financial fraud or environmental degradation, can now be investigated with greater depth and precision. Platforms like can play a role in supporting data-driven journalism by providing access to relevant datasets and resources. Collaborations between journalists, data scientists, and academic researchers can further enhance the impact of investigative reporting, shedding light on critical issues and holding powerful institutions accountable. This represents an exciting frontier for journalism, promising more impactful and evidence-based reporting.

Furthermore, the increased accessibility of satellite imagery, open-source intelligence (OSINT), and social media analytics is enabling journalists to monitor events in remote or inaccessible locations. These tools can be used to document human rights abuses, track the flow of refugees, or investigate environmental crimes. However, it’s crucial to verify the authenticity of data obtained through these sources and to protect the privacy and safety of individuals involved. Ethical considerations must remain paramount when utilizing these emerging technologies for investigative reporting, ensuring responsible and transparent practices.
